The UKYPE award is run by the British Council, who run a series of other awards for entrepreneurs across the creative industries as part of their Creative Economy programme. They have a market focus each year, and this year it is South Africa; last year it was India. The Free Word centre recently opened its doors to the world. We attended the launch event and spoke to a number of the high profile speakers and guests asking “What does Free Word mean to you?” Located in the former Guardian Newspaper building on Farringdon Road and currently home to nine organisations, Free Word is a builiding dedicated to promoting literature, literacy and freedom of expression.
